Plugins pushing many small frames should disable compression, since the per-frame overhead dominates; plugins streaming large JSON snapshots benefit substantially. Measure before toggling — the relay exposes per-connection compression ratios in its stats endpoint. Compression settings live in your plugin's .env alongside connection options. Set WS_COMPRESSION to on or off explicitly rather than relying on defaults. To authenticate your plugin against the relay, place your token on the next line.

sealed setting: ARCHIVE_KEY3=8d0

Alert: BrokerUpgradePending — the Relayforge message broker in the Oakhollow cluster is scheduled for a major version upgrade. During the cutover, producers will queue locally for up to ten minutes; verify that consumer lag returns to baseline before approving the release train. Do not ship releases that add new topics until the upgrade completes. If lag persists beyond thirty minutes, notify the broker team at the address below.

pager mailbox: praix@zarqelstack.internal

Subject: Goods lift reserved overnight — Pellway House

Hi night team,

The goods lift is reserved from 11pm to 4am tonight for the Tarnbeck furniture delivery. Please keep the loading bay corridor clear and direct the crew to Level 3 only. Regular staff should use the stairs during this window. To release the lift for the delivery crew, enter the code below.

staff pass of kawip-hawef = bdg-QLP-2